The Chhattisgarh High Court has ruled that Aadhaar is not conclusive proof of age in accident claims. This judgment has significant implications for insurance claims.

The Chhattisgarh High Court has made a significant ruling regarding the use of Aadhaar as proof of age in accident claims. According to the court, Aadhaar cannot be considered as conclusive proof of age. This judgment is expected to have a significant impact on the insurance sector, particularly in cases where the claimant's age is a crucial factor in determining the claim amount. The court's decision is based on the understanding that Aadhaar is primarily an identity document and not a definitive proof of age.
